Yellowjacket extermination services focus on safely and effectively eliminating yellowjackets from residential properties. These services typically involve identifying the location of the nest, which is often concealed underground or within wall cavities, and then applying targeted treatments to eradicate the colony. Professionals use specialized equipment and techniques to remove the nests without causing unnecessary damage to the property or risking stings to inhabitants. The goal is to provide a thorough solution that minimizes the risk of future infestations and ensures the safety of everyone on the property.

These services help solve common problems associated with yellowjackets, such as aggressive behavior when nests are disturbed and the potential for painful stings, especially for those allergic to insect venom. Yellowjackets can become particularly problematic during late summer and early fall when colonies are at their largest. They tend to scavenge food around outdoor gatherings, trash cans, and sugary drinks, creating nuisance situations. Extermination services are designed to address these issues by removing the nests and reducing the presence of yellowjackets, helping homeowners enjoy their outdoor spaces without worry.

Properties that typically use yellowjacket extermination services include single-family homes, vacation residences, and outdoor event spaces. Homes with yards, gardens, or patios are often targeted because the presence of nests nearby can pose safety concerns for residents and visitors. Commercial properties such as outdoor dining areas, parks, and recreational facilities also frequently require professional removal to maintain a safe environment. In addition, properties with children, pets, or allergy sufferers are more likely to seek out expert assistance to prevent accidental stings and related health issues.

What are yellowjackets? Yellowjackets are a type of wasp known for their aggressive behavior and painful stings, often building nests in outdoor areas.

How do local contractors typically handle yellowjacket infestations? They usually identify and remove nests safely, using specialized equipment and treatments to eliminate the colony.

Are there signs that indicate a yellowjacket nest nearby? Common signs include increased activity around outdoor structures, visible nests, and frequent buzzing or stinging incidents.

What safety precautions do service providers take during removal? Professionals wear protective gear and follow proper procedures to minimize risk during nest removal or treatment.

Can yellowjacket problems be prevented in the future? Some prevention methods include sealing entry points, removing food sources, and maintaining yard cleanliness to discourage nesting.
